from subprocess import CalledProcessError import pytest import pystencils import pystencils.cpu.cpujit from pystencils.backends.cbackend import CBackend from pystencils.backends.cuda_backend import CudaBackend from pystencils.enums import Target class ScreamingBackend(CBackend): def _print(self, node): normal_code = super()._print(node) return normal_code.upper() class ScreamingGpuBackend(CudaBackend): def _print(self, node): normal_code = super()._print(node) return normal_code.upper() def test_custom_backends_cpu(): z, y, x = pystencils.fields("z, y, x: [2d]") normal_assignments = pystencils.AssignmentCollection([pystencils.Assignment( z[0, 0], x[0, 0] * x[0, 0] * y[0, 0])], []) ast = pystencils.create_kernel(normal_assignments, target=Target.CPU) pystencils.show_code(ast, ScreamingBackend()) with pytest.raises(CalledProcessError): pystencils.cpu.cpujit.make_python_function(ast, custom_backend=ScreamingBackend()) def test_custom_backends_gpu(): pytest.importorskip('cupy') import cupy import pystencils.gpu.gpujit z, x, y = pystencils.fields("z, y, x: [2d]") normal_assignments = pystencils.AssignmentCollection([pystencils.Assignment( z[0, 0], x[0, 0] * x[0, 0] * y[0, 0])], []) ast = pystencils.create_kernel(normal_assignments, target=Target.GPU) pystencils.show_code(ast, ScreamingGpuBackend()) with pytest.raises((cupy.cuda.compiler.JitifyException, cupy.cuda.compiler.CompileException)): pystencils.gpu.gpujit.make_python_function(ast, custom_backend=ScreamingGpuBackend())
